English: Publicity photo of the original line-up of American blues-rock band Double Trouble, circa 1983. From left to right: Chris Layton, Stevie Ray Vaughan, and Tommy Shannon.

English: The publicity photo was published between 1978 and March 1, 1989 without a valid copyright notice. Searches of the online Copyright Catalog (1978–present) show there was no registration for the photo, which would have been necessary to file within five years of its publication to establish copyright.

This work is in the public domain because it was published in the United States between 1978 and March 1, 1989 without a copyright notice, and its copyright was not subsequently registered with the U.S. Copyright Office within 5 years. Unless its author has been dead for several years, it is copyrighted in the countries or areas that do not apply the rule of the shorter term for US works, such as Canada (50 pma), Mainland China (50 pma, not Hong Kong or Macau), Germany (70 pma), Mexico (100 pma), Switzerland (70 pma), and other countries with individual treaties. English: A very similar alternate photo from the same session was uploaded as Stevie Ray Vaughan And Double Trouble Don Hunstein.jpg (archive link). However, unlike this photo, for that photo there is no proof it was actually published between 1978 and and March 1, 1989, with or without a copyright notice. Therefore, it cannot be determined whether that alternate photo remains copyrighted or not.
